"Joe \"Marcus\" Clarke" writes:
> I have noticed that the adduser command under this SNAP does not
> correctly add users to /etc/group.  I have to manually edit this file to
> get users to correspond to their respective groups.

Are you talking about primary or secondary group memberships?

A user's primary group membership should not appear in /etc/groups
if that group's uid is in /etc/master.passwd. That is redundant.

The only exception to this is when adding a member to group wheel.
su only looks at /etc/group in this case (which, actually, I consider
a bug, but not a large one).
